The number of employees across four professional technician sectors has grown by 2.8%, says a new report from TechForce Foundation.
That includes auto service technicians, as well as collision, diesel and aviation technicians.
The recently released “2024 Transportation Technician Supply & Demand Report” notes that for the second year in a row, “the number of post-secondary graduates” has increased.
The 2.8% increase signals “steady progress in filling the jobs pipeline” and outpaces the overall U.S. labor force growth rate of 2%.
“As an organization that — together with our donors and partners — works to correct the imbalance between technician supply and demand, it is encouraging to see continued growth in the number of graduates preparing to step into technician careers,” says Jennifer Maher, CEO of TechForce Foundation.
